The condition of a surface plays a crucial role in various fields, including construction, manufacturing, and even art. A surface's texture, smoothness, and cleanliness can significantly influence the performance and aesthetics of a final product. For instance, in construction, the condition of surface refers to how well-prepared a surface is for painting or applying finishes. If the surface is rough or dirty, it may not hold paint properly, leading to peeling or uneven coverage. Therefore, understanding and assessing the condition of surface is essential for achieving high-quality results.In manufacturing, the condition of surface can affect the functionality of mechanical parts. Components that fit together must have precisely machined surfaces to ensure proper operation. Any irregularities can lead to increased friction, wear, and ultimately, failure of the machinery. Thus, engineers pay close attention to the condition of surface during the production process, often using advanced technologies such as laser scanning or surface profiling to measure and analyze surface characteristics.Moreover, in the world of art, the condition of surface can determine the longevity and visual impact of a piece. Artists choose specific surfaces for their work, whether it be canvas, wood, or metal, each with its unique condition of surface that affects how paints and other materials adhere. A well-prepared surface allows for smoother application and better color representation, while a poorly prepared one can detract from the artwork's overall quality.In addition to these practical applications, the condition of surface also has environmental implications. For example, in the case of roadways, the condition of surface affects vehicle safety and fuel efficiency. Smooth, well-maintained roads reduce tire wear and improve gas mileage, while potholes and rough patches can lead to accidents and increased emissions due to inefficient driving conditions.Furthermore, the condition of surface is vital in scientific research, particularly in studies involving soil and ecological assessments. The surface condition of soil can influence water retention, erosion rates, and habitat suitability for various species. Researchers often analyze the condition of surface in different ecosystems to understand better how human activities impact natural environments.In conclusion, the condition of surface is a multifaceted concept that extends beyond simple appearances. It encompasses numerous factors that can affect functionality, aesthetics, and environmental sustainability across various disciplines. Whether in construction, manufacturing, art, transportation, or environmental science, recognizing and improving the condition of surface is vital for achieving optimal outcomes and ensuring long-lasting results. As we continue to innovate and develop new technologies, our understanding of the condition of surface will undoubtedly evolve, leading to even more significant advancements in multiple fields.
